Magnezone base stats: 70/70/115/130/90/60
Heliolisk base stats (from Smogon): 60/65/50/120/100/120

I'd say depends on what your team needs. Heliolisk is more of a glass cannon sweeper whereas Magnezone is more bulky but slower. Though I'm not sure where to evolve Magneton in XY.

I didn't feel as if a certain type was necessary going through the game. You'll get Thunderbolt as a TM along the story so you are able to just use that as well.
